Output 43bc5feee15c7a3cb99633923b03f05928ce46d38763287548c148e30a45f029:0

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b8ff994ce72767d0d54bf5c3753634921f39940 OP_EQUAL
address
32k9qCyD3pSo9776d8VMoarMBXQuDeVjRF
transaction
43bc5feee15c7a3cb99633923b03f05928ce46d38763287548c148e30a45f029
spent
true